Abstract: The objective of this project is to study simulations of hyperbolic encounters of black holes (BHs) using a 1.5 Post-Newtonian approximation and assess its validity by comparing the data calculated on the movement and on gravitational wave (GW) radiation with the results provided by numerical relativity simulations. The PN approximations are known to not always converge, but they are suitable in some regions of parameters space. For the region of parameters explored, we find that the best results are obtained if the expansion of the GW radiation is truncated at the leading order
